Lmb Enterprises Salary

As of August 2026, the average hourly salary for employees at Lmb Enterprises in the United States is $38. This translates to an approximate annual wage of $78,028. Salaries at Lmb Enterprises typically range from $33 to $43 hourly,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Costa Mesa?

Understanding the cost of living near Costa Mesa is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Lmb Enterprises.
Costa Mesa's Cost of Living Index is approximately 175.9 (75.9% more expensive than US average; 25.8% more than CA average). Orange County city near coast, South Coast Plaza, very high housing costs. When planning your budget based on a salary from Lmb Enterprises,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$2,500 - $3,700+ A significant portion of Lmb Enterprises sal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$160 - $270 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$69 (OCT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$480 - $710 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$500 - $900+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$410 - $780+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$4,119 - $6,369+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
